WebDec 20, 2024 · However, you should be careful not to over-mist your fiddle leaf fig. too much water can cause the leaves to yellow and drop off. It is best to mist the plant in the morning so that the leaves have time to dry before nightfall. Misting fiddle leaf figs is an effective way to replicate humidity. Avoid using anything to wipe your leaves besides a very soft cloth, and only give it a gentle wipe-down. … WebDec 8, 2024 · You technically need to mist your fiddle leaf fig a few times a day to make a lasting impact on the humidity level around your plant. This is because misting only raises the humidity around your plants for a few minutes. Many plant lovers mist their tropical plants, like the fiddle leaf fig, every day. Choose a new pot large enough to accommodate the plant’s size and growth rate. Repot into well-draining soil and water after repotting.

WebJan 4, 2024 · Fiddle leaf fig plants do fine in regular potting mix soil. You should repot your fiddle leaf fig every 18-24 months in a pot 1 to 2 inches larger to promote growth. If your tree is looking fatigued or its leaves are browning, set up a humidifier nearby—or at least … chelsea flower show shopsWebAug 5, 2024 · Water slowly and deeply, until water runs out of the drainage holes at the bottom of the pot. Never let your fiddle leaf fig sit in water, as this can lead to root rot. If the plant is sitting in a saucer, empty it out after 30 minutes.
